Structural analyses are done with MSC.MARC. The relative open structure of the software enables BPO to do detailed FEM (Finite Element Method) analyses of the most complex load cases.
When appropriate, BPO simulates non-linear material behaviour of plastics and metals (steel, aluminium, Zamac), large displacement and deformation effects, multiple zone contact problems and structural dynamics. These advanced simulation techniques are used to analyse e.g. creep of plastics, deformation during assembly or dropping of complete Europallets. BPO does not hesitate to program its own subroutines in order to achieve more accurate results in a shorter time.
BPO also uses Optistruct. With this advanced software, products and mechanisms can be optimised automatically. It is especially useful for single products which have to be optimised for several different load cases. Typical examples are hinges, joints or struts.
